Performance and Capability of the 2022 Ford Bronco
Alright, let's talk about what really matters: performance! The 2022 Ford Bronco is built to conquer the great outdoors, and its performance capabilities are a testament to that fact. Edmunds' reviews often highlight the Bronco's impressive off-road prowess, noting its robust suspension, available four-wheel-drive systems, and a variety of engine options that deliver the power you need to tackle any terrain. The base engine is a peppy 2.3-liter EcoBoost inline-four, which provides a good balance of power and fuel efficiency. If you're looking for more grunt, the available 2.7-liter EcoBoost V6 is a real powerhouse, offering significantly more horsepower and torque for those demanding off-road situations or highway merges. We have to give props to the standard four-wheel-drive system, which is a must-have for serious off-roading. It features a transfer case with multiple modes, allowing you to switch between two-wheel drive for daily driving and four-wheel drive for tackling tougher conditions. Some trims also offer an advanced 4x4 system with a two-speed electromechanical transfer case, providing even greater control and capability.
Off-road enthusiasts will appreciate the Bronco's impressive ground clearance, approach and departure angles, and available features like a disconnecting front sway bar for enhanced articulation. These features allow the Bronco to navigate challenging obstacles with ease, whether you're crawling over rocks or traversing muddy trails. Edmunds typically evaluates these features in their real-world testing, providing insights into how the Bronco performs in various off-road scenarios. The transmission options are also worth noting. The Bronco comes standard with a seven-speed manual transmission (including a crawler gear for extreme off-roading). However, most buyers opt for the available 10-speed automatic, which offers smooth shifts and responsive performance. Edmunds' testers often praise the automatic transmission for its responsiveness and ability to handle various driving conditions. It’s worth noting that the Bronco's performance isn't just about off-road capability. It also provides a comfortable and capable on-road experience. The suspension is tuned to absorb bumps and imperfections, and the steering feels precise and responsive. The Bronco also offers a range of driving modes, including Normal, Eco, Sport, Slippery, Sand, and Mud/Ruts, allowing you to customize the driving experience to suit your preferences and the current conditions. Interior Comfort and Features
Now, let's step inside! The 2022 Ford Bronco doesn't just excel in off-road performance; it also offers a surprisingly comfortable and well-equipped interior. Edmunds typically comments on the Bronco's rugged yet functional design, highlighting the use of durable materials and user-friendly features. The interior is designed to withstand the rigors of off-road adventures, with features like washable floors (available on some trims) and marine-grade vinyl upholstery. The Bronco offers a range of seating configurations and trim levels, allowing you to customize the interior to your liking. Base models offer a more utilitarian design, while higher trims feature upgraded materials and amenities.
One of the standout features of the Bronco's interior is its removable doors and roof, which provides an open-air experience unlike any other SUV. Edmunds' reviews often mention the ease of removing and storing these components, allowing you to fully immerse yourself in the great outdoors. The infotainment system is another key aspect of the Bronco's interior. It features a touchscreen display with Ford's SYNC system, which provides access to a variety of features, including navigation, smartphone integration, and audio controls. The Bronco also offers a range of available technology features, such as a premium sound system, a wireless charging pad, and a digital instrument cluster. Edmunds' Expert Take: Pros and Cons
What does Edmunds really think about the 2022 Ford Bronco? Well, they've got some insightful pros and cons that can help you make a decision. Edmunds often highlights the Bronco's strengths and weaknesses, giving you a balanced view of the vehicle. One of the biggest pros, of course, is its incredible off-road capability. The Bronco is designed to tackle tough terrain, with its robust suspension, four-wheel-drive system, and available features like a disconnecting front sway bar. Edmunds' reviewers consistently praise the Bronco's ability to conquer obstacles that would stop other SUVs in their tracks. Another major pro is its retro styling. The Bronco's design is a nod to the original, and it's a real head-turner. Edmunds often comments on the Bronco's distinctive appearance and its ability to stand out from the crowd. Plus, the removable doors and roof are a huge bonus for those who love open-air adventures.
However, there are also some cons to consider. Edmunds may point out that the Bronco's on-road ride can be a bit rough, especially on some trims. The off-road-oriented suspension can make the ride a bit less refined than some competitors. Another potential drawback is the Bronco's fuel economy. With its powerful engines and off-road-focused design, the Bronco isn't the most fuel-efficient SUV on the market. Edmunds provides detailed fuel economy figures, so you can compare it to other SUVs in its class. Edmunds' reviews also often mention the Bronco's interior, which, while functional and durable, may not be as luxurious as some of its rivals. However, the available premium features, like heated seats and a premium sound system, can help to mitigate this. Overall, Edmunds' expert take on the 2022 Ford Bronco is generally positive. The pros, such as its off-road capability and unique styling, often outweigh the cons for many buyers. But it's essential to consider the trade-offs, like the potential for a rougher on-road ride and lower fuel economy.
